B.K. TERMINAL DELI inspected: 105 violation points
Summary: B.K. TERMINAL DELI was inspected on May 6, 2008, and 7 violations were cited, resulting in 105 violation points. Because the restaurant received more than 27 violation points, a follow-up inspection was required. Read more about what this means.
